1. Greet members and guests by name as they enter the facility; always provide excellent customer service.
2. Check-in members register guests collect appropriate fees as necessary.
3. Assist with member retention and new member sales; inform Member Services Specialist of all prospect inquiries and take new prospect on a facility tour.
4. Schedule all service programming and social event appointments and registrations according to facility policies.
5. Process registration forms for all facility programs.
6. Receive all incoming phone calls and direct them to the appropriate department; receive all incoming mail/packages and direct to appropriate department.
7. Collect all programming activity merchandise and member fees as required POS transactions.
8. Monitor supplies take inventory restock.
9. Promote all facility programs trainings and social events including program philosophy policies and procedures to members guests and prospects.
10. Maintain front desk area in a neat and orderly fashion; ensure optimal organization.
11. Present with a neat well-groomed appearance at all times.
12. Attend all departmental staff meetings.
13. Abide by all department and facility policies and procedures.
14. All other duties as assigned by the Operations Manager or designee.
Education: High School Diploma or equivalent.
Skills: Demonstrate proficiency of basic math skills. Be able to handle multiple duties. Maintain regular attendance and punctuality. Maintain a positive attitude. Have the ability to work under pressure and maintain customer service orientation. Have telephone skills and sales/promotional aptitude.
